Dirty Blogging Secrets Unveiled
I have got some secrets to tell you… Pssst… Promise me you won’t share it with anyone?
I have been blogging since many years, and I am doing quite well. I feel like I am sharing the secrets of blogging with everyone. Yet, there are few things I don’t want anyone to know, not even my favorite readers or fellow bloggers.
Lately, I found these secrets are kept by most of the bloggers from around the world. If not all, they have at least few of the ones mentioned below. Here is the list of things we all bloggers want to keep secret. Again, please don’t mention anyone that I shared it with you.
- Aren’t We Making Up Few Things?
Definitely not every thing we write is made up, but few things, yes. We try something, we like it because it works, and we pass it on to others through our blogs. But there are some things we just make it up and test if it works. And if it doesn’t, we try to make up something else.C’mon, we all do it. But we don’t have what it takes to accept it. Not everything that a blogger writes is tested and proved.
- And We Are Always Afraid About It
Since not every article we post is genuine, we feel our readers, or other bloggers, or some one else will find it out sooner or later. And we will stand naked with crowd pointing at us, laughing.If you want to know who has this fear, search for bloggers who write confidently about everything. I am sure, majority of us does this. We want to hide our fears and don’t want to show that we have made up something. Hence, we write confidently about every thing. - We Don’t Use Our Own Suggestions
Don’t you think the people who write about motivation are never un-motivated or bored? They are. Why don’t they follow their own suggestions? I too preach about blogging, creativity, SEO, motivation, and so on, but sometimes I just feel like running away from all this for few days. At that time, I don’t feel like reading my own suggestions and using them. - We All Are Lazy
Yet, we write about hard work, determination, courage, etc. All human beings are lazy, only the level of laziness differs. The truth is nobody is perfect. We just try to create an illusion, through our blogs, that we are perfect, and hard working, and blah, blah, blah. - We Are Not Creators, We Are Just Followers
The ideas we share are never original. We pick up an advice, modify it, decorate it, improve it a bit, and present it to our readers. Absolutely nothing in this blogsphere is original. The same ideas are being circulated but with a personal, different perspective. One in a while, however, a new idea comes in, and we all pounce on it, to be the first one to modify it. - Yet, We Love Our Blogs
In spite of all these flaws, we love it. One, because we preach about loving our job. Two, it’s easy and fun. And Three, it makes money.
